Md. Code Ann., Agric. § 4-311.7
Keeping of records
Effective Oct 1, 2020Added by Acts 1993, c. 542. Amended by Acts 2002, c. 201, § 1, eff. Oct. 1, 2002; Acts 2020, c. 496, § 1, eff. Oct. 1, 2020.State of Maryland
(a) A packer or distributor shall:
- (1) Keep accurate records showing the number of eggs sold or delivered to any person;
- (2) Keep required records at each place of business or at a central location within the State;
- (3) Keep required records for 1 year; and
- (4) Make required egg records available to the Secretary upon request.
- (b) A retailer or food service facility shall keep each invoice delivery ticket received in accordance with § 4-308 of this subtitle for 90 days.
